Career path

Career Role in Healthcare Advocacy & Regulation (UK) Description
Healthcare Policy Analyst Researching and analyzing healthcare policies, providing data-driven insights for advocacy campaigns. Significant regulatory knowledge required.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ist Navigating complex regulatory landscapes, ensuring compliance for healthcare organizations. Deep understanding of healthcare regulations is crucial.
Health Policy Advisor Advising government bodies and stakeholders on healthcare policy development and implementation. Strong advocacy and communication skills are essential.
Public Health Advocate Championing public health initiatives and advocating for improved healthcare access and outcomes. Excellent communication and influencing skills are needed.
Legal Counsel (Healthcare Regulation) Providing legal expertise on healthcare regulations, advising clients on compliance and litigation. Expertise in medical law and healthcare regulations is critical.
